Building with Insulated Concrete Forms

Insulated Concrete Form construction is a high-performance building method that uses reinforced concrete and integrated insulation to create durable, energy-efficient structures. Performance, Efficiency, and Durability

ICF construction provides enhanced structural strength, improved energy performance, and increased resistance to environmental factors. Homes built with ICF systems can offer consistent indoor comfort, reduced energy demands, and long-term durability.
